How will your role help us transform hope into reality?

The Senior Director, Corporate Legal Affairs will use their understanding of securities law and corporate governance, the biopharmaceutical industry, and Blueprint Medicines’ business to provide pragmatic legal advice that advances the company’s business and protects the company’s interests. Reporting to the VP, Corporate Legal Affairs, you will have the opportunity to directly contribute to the company’s success by partnering with teams in the United States and Europe on a broad range of matters, including SEC and Nasdaq reporting and compliance, equity programs, capital markets activities, and external communications. What will you do?

  • Handle SEC and Nasdaq reporting and compliance, including preparing, reviewing, and filing Forms 10-K, 10-Q, 8-K, registration statements, Section 16 filings, proxy statements, and other annual shareholders meeting materials.
  • Partner with cross-functional teams to review press releases, investor call scripts, FAQs, congress and conference materials, social media postings, website content, webinar materials, publications, and other external and internal communications.
  • Co-manage disclosure committee meetings with cross-functional stakeholders.
  • Assist with capital markets activities, including due diligence matters.
  • Assist with materials for the board of directors and its committees, including drafting resolutions, minutes, and written consents, and attend meetings according to business needs.
  • Assist with the onboarding/off-boarding of officers and directors, as needed.
  • Manage the annual D&O questionnaires process.
  • Provide advice and guidance to the Finance, Human Resources, and international teams related to equity incentive programs, insider trading policies and procedures, and other matters.
  • Manage the insiders list, insiders pre-clearance process, review of 10b5-1 plans, and other trading restrictions.
  • Conduct employee onboarding and refresher training related to public company status (e.g., insider trading, individual reporting requirements) and other matters.
  • Partner with the Investor Relations team in connection with outreach to investor stewardship teams and development of the company’s annual corporate social responsibility report.
  • Develop and maintain policies and procedures to ensure compliance with SEC regulations, Nasdaq listing requirements, Sarbanes-Oxley and other applicable regulatory requirements, as needed.
  • Act as a department representative on company initiatives, as assigned.
  • Maintain a solid understanding of applicable laws, regulations, and enforcement actions to identify emerging risks, keep teams advised, and implement or revise policies and training programs, as appropriate.

Blueprint Medicines is a global, fully integrated biopharmaceutical company that invents life-changing medicines. We seek to alleviate human suffering by solving important medical problems in two core focus areas: allergy/inflammation and oncology/hematology. Our approach begins by targeting the root causes of disease, using deep scientific knowledge in our core focus areas and drug discovery expertise across multiple therapeutic modalities. We have a proven track record of success with two approved medicines, including bringing our medicine to patients with systemic mastocytosis (SM) in the U.S. and Europe. Leveraging our established research, development, and commercial capability and infrastructure, we now aim to significantly scale our impact by advancing a broad pipeline of programs ranging from early science to advanced clinical trials in mast cell diseases including SM and chronic urticaria, breast cancer and other solid tumors.
